I am afraid this is going to be a rambling reply, but I just finished an ABS brake odessy. For me the ten amp fuse in the ABS relay box blew first. This led to discovering that the Pressure switch on the passenger side of the ABS Brake master cylinder had gotten so corroded that when I tried to take off the plug, it took one of the male spade connectors with it. I took the ABS Master Cylinder out about 4 times, replacing it with one from Fleabay. The four times in and out thing relates to the fact that I took the electric motor off of the newer assembly and put it back on incorrectly by putting the screen filter in backwards thereby preventing fluid from being pumped into the accumulator. The newer electric pump motor spun much more easily than the older one. I eventually also found that a 10 amp fuse in the fuse block under APC had also blown. I worry that your electric motor is cruddy and pulling so much juice that it blows the relay. BUT the relay is supposed to be fuse protected, so I don't understand. Maybe your accumulator is so bad that the pump must run too long and that is what blows the relay. Not the problem you want to have. Do you have a bentley manual and can trace the schematics?
